KIDSHINE LTD 

Primarily to advance in life and relieve the needs of young people through:A. Providing support and activities, in particular mentoring support and mentoring training to those with low self-esteem and low self-confidence, which develop their skills, capacities and capabilities to enable them to participate in society as mature and responsible individuals for the public benefit. Objectives

TO ADVANCE IN LIFE AND RELIEVE THE NEEDS OF YOUNG PEOPLE THROUGH:A. PROVIDING SUPPORT AND ACTIVITIES, IN PARTICULAR MENTORING SUPPORT AND MENTORING TRAINING TO THOSE WITH LOW SELF-ESTEEM AND LOW SELF-CONFIDENCE, WHICH DEVELOP THEIR SKILLS, CAPACITIES AND CAPABILITIES TO ENABLE THEM TO PARTICIPATE IN SOCIETY AS MATURE AND RESPONSIBLE INDIVIDUALS FOR THE PUBLIC BENEFIT.B. PROVIDING RECREATIONAL AND LEISURE TIME ACTIVITIES PROVIDED IN THE INTEREST OF SOCIAL WELFARE, DESIGNED TO IMPROVE THEIR CONDITIONS OF LIFE FOR THE PUBLIC BENEFIT.C. PROVIDING INFORMATION AND ADVICE TO PARENTS AND CARERS OF YOUNG PEOPLE WITH LOW SELF-ESTEEM AND LOW SELF-CONFIDENCE, RELEVANT TO THE NEEDS OF THOSE YOUNG PEOPLE, FOR THE PUBLIC BENEFIT.
